Give out plans to visit Taiwan in the rainy season! Where can you travel? 🇹🇼✨

Taiwan Taipei rainy season is not cool! Fah is the one who has been to Taiwan rainy-summer for 3 years. I will say that I can travel. Take a beautiful picture, not losing any other season.

List of excursions

- Tamsui, the port city by the bay.

- Keelung, Rainbow Harbor

- Jiufen, the village on the hill.

- Houtong Cat Village Cat Village

- Ximending popular pedestrian street

- National Museum Taiwan National Museum

- Huashan 1914 creative park cool

- Taipei Zoo

- 7-11 Sanrio Seven Kitty Super Brow

Everywhere you can travel, not far from the railway station in the sky to June-Aug. Taiwan rainy season is great. 🥳
